Effective July 04, 2022, Canada is going to let Parents and Grandparents stay in Canada for up to 5 years per entry by Super Visa.

Parents and grandparents may also be allowed to get International medical insurance, therefore spending less on insurance coverage.

Individuals who are currently in Canada with a super visa can extend their stay up to two years, meaning a super visa holder can stay for up to 7 years in Canada.

Approximately 17,000 Super Visas are issued by Canada annually.

2025 Update—Canada’s Super Visa allows parents and grandparents of Canadian citizens and PRs to stay in Canada for up to 5 years per entry. Those already in Canada on a Super Visa can apply for an extension of up to 2 additional years, meaning a possible stay of up to 7 years without leaving the country.

Canada issues around 17,000 Super Visas every year, providing a long-term option for family visits. One of the main requirements is having medical insurance that covers healthcare in Canada.

A key change in 2025 is that Super Visa applicants are now allowed to purchase medical insurance from international providers, not just Canadian companies. The foreign insurance must meet Canada’s requirements, including a minimum of $100,000 coverage for healthcare, hospitalization, and repatriation. This update gives applicants more flexibility and potential savings on insurance costs.

Additionally, the 2025 Parents and Grandparents Sponsorship Program (PGP) will accept up to 10,000 applications. However, due to a backlog, invitations to apply are only being sent to people who submitted their interest forms in 2020.
PGP applications currently take about 24 months to process for most provinces and up to 48 months for applicants applying through Quebec.
